ALF is an American sitcom that aired on NBC from September 22, 1986 to March 24, 1990. It was the first television series to be presented in Dolby Surround sound system.

The title character is Gordon Shumway, a friendly extraterrestrial nicknamed ALF (an acronym for Alien Life Form), who crash lands in the garage of the suburban middle-class Tanner family. The series stars Max Wright as father Willie Tanner, Anne Schedeen as mother Kate Tanner, and Andrea Elson and Benji Gregory as their children, Lynn and Brian Tanner. ALF was performed by puppeteer/creator Paul Fusco.

Produced by Alien Productions, ALF originally ran for four seasons and produced 99 episodes, including three one-hour episodes which were divided into two parts for syndication totaling 102 episodes.

ALF also have two Saturday morning animated series distributed by DiC Entertainment acted as prequels to the live-action sitcom on ALF's life back on Melmac before its eventual destruction from nuclear war.

ALF also did have a TV movie on ABC in 1996, "Project: ALF", which it takes after the series finale of the sitcom that was ended in a cliffhanger where the Alien Task Force finally caught ALF.

ALF did have his own talk show on Nick at Nite's TV Land in 2004. It was short lived, it ran from July 7th to December 17th, 2004.
